Vinyl plank flooring has rapidly become one of the most popular flooring options due to its durability, affordability, and realistic wood-like appearance. When choosing vinyl planks, many consumers and professionals wonder about the protective coatings applied to these floors, especially whether vinyl planks are coated with aluminum oxide. This article provides an in-depth exploration of the use of aluminum oxide coatings on vinyl plank flooring, the benefits they offer, how they compare to other coatings, and practical advice for selecting and maintaining vinyl floors.
Aluminum oxide (Al₂O₃) is a naturally occurring compound known for its exceptional hardness and durability. It is widely used as an abrasive in sandpapers, grinding wheels, and polishing compounds. In flooring, aluminum oxide is incorporated into the wear layer or finish to provide a tough, scratch-resistant surface that protects the floor from daily wear and tear.
In vinyl plank flooring (VPL), the wear layer is the topmost transparent coating that takes the brunt of foot traffic, spills, and impacts. Adding aluminum oxide to this layer enhances the floor's resistance to scratches, scuffs, stains, and fading, extending its lifespan and preserving its appearance.
The short answer is: Many high-quality vinyl planks do feature an aluminum oxide coating, but not all. The presence and quality of this coating vary by manufacturer and product line.
During the manufacturing process, a clear wear layer is applied over the printed design layer of the vinyl plank. This wear layer typically consists of urethane or acrylic resins mixed with aluminum oxide particles. The aluminum oxide is either suspended within the coating or sprinkled onto the wet layer before curing.
This coating is then cured—often using UV light—to harden and bond the aluminum oxide particles firmly to the surface, creating a durable, protective finish.
Aluminum oxide is one of the hardest materials used in flooring finishes. Its inclusion in the wear layer significantly improves resistance to scratches from furniture, pets, and everyday foot traffic.
Floors with aluminum oxide coatings typically last longer and maintain their appearance better than those without. This reduces the need for early replacement or refinishing.
Aluminum oxide coatings often contain UV inhibitors that help prevent color fading and yellowing caused by sunlight exposure, preserving the floor's aesthetic appeal.
The hard, smooth surface created by aluminum oxide coatings resists dirt and stains, making cleaning easier and more effective.
Although vinyl planks with aluminum oxide coatings may have a higher upfront cost, their durability and reduced maintenance needs make them more economical in the long run.
Many vinyl planks use urethane or acrylic wear layers without aluminum oxide. While these coatings provide some protection, they are more prone to scratching and wear.
Some manufacturers use ceramic bead additives as an alternative to aluminum oxide. Ceramic beads also enhance scratch resistance but may differ in cost and performance characteristics.
Lower-end vinyl planks may have minimal or no protective coatings, making them less suitable for high-traffic areas.
- Product Specifications: Check manufacturer datasheets or packaging for mention of aluminum oxide or ceramic bead wear layers.
- Wear Layer Thickness: Thicker wear layers (12 mils or more) often indicate the presence of durable coatings like aluminum oxide.
- Brand Reputation: Premium brands typically include aluminum oxide in their wear layers.
- Visual Inspection: While difficult to see directly, aluminum oxide coatings result in a harder, more scratch-resistant surface.
- Assess Traffic Levels: For high-traffic areas, choose vinyl planks with thicker wear layers containing aluminum oxide.
- Consider Pet and Child Safety: Homes with pets and children benefit from the enhanced durability.
- Budget Wisely: Balance upfront cost with expected lifespan and maintenance savings.
- Request Samples: Test samples for scratch resistance and finish quality.
- Verify Warranty: Look for manufacturer warranties that specify protection against wear and scratches.
- Regular Cleaning: Use gentle cleaners and avoid abrasive tools.
- Protective Measures: Use furniture pads and avoid dragging heavy objects.
- Avoid Harsh Chemicals: Strong solvents can degrade the wear layer.
- Prompt Spill Cleanup: Prevent staining and damage by cleaning spills immediately.
- “Thicker Wear Layer Always Means Better Performance”
While thickness matters, the quality and composition of the wear layer, including aluminum oxide content, are equally important.
- “All Vinyl Planks Have Aluminum Oxide Coatings”
Not all do; many budget options lack this feature.
- “Aluminum Oxide Makes Floors Uncomfortable”
The coating is microscopic and does not affect the floor's comfort or feel.
